Among Utah's finest restaurants, The New Yorker maintains an air of quiet sophistication, with rich woods, understated elegance, excellent food, and impeccable service. From the continually evolving dinner menu, hope for the Maryland crab cakes, which are as good as -- or better than -- those you'll find anywhere; the certified Angus beef filet mignon with cabernet-mustard sauce or the roasted rack of American lamb. Lunch brings dishes such as deep-fried Gulf white shrimp, served with fries, coleslaw, and cocktail sauce; veal schnitzel with green peppercorns and lemon butter sauce; or sandwiches and salads. The less formal cafe serves scaled-down fare, such as a bacon-and-avocado burger, fried camembert and pear with red pepper jelly, and an excellent cobb salad. Full liquor service is available with a $4 membership.
